CROSS COUNTRY: Utah Valley's Karinne Bentley and Jacob Buhler have been named to the 2010 CoSIDA ESPN the Magazine Academic All-District Men's and Women's Track Cross Country Team, as announced June 3 by the Academic All-America Committee. Both were District 8 Second Team selections.
Bentley, a senior from St. George, Utah, maintained a 3.89 GPA while studying Exercise Science during her four-year track and cross country career at UVU. Bentley was also one of the top distance runners for the Wolverines during her career. This past year, she placed third overall at the Great West Conference Cross Country Championships in the fall and just a couple of weeks ago finished third in the 3,000-meter steeplechase, fourth in the 5,000-meter run, and fifth in the 800 meters at the GWC Outdoor Track and Field Championships.
Buhler, a senior from Military, N.D., held a 3.72 GPA while majoring in Biology during his four years at UVU as well. Buhler who is also a distance runner that competed in both track and cross country had a huge senior year in both sports. Buhler was UVU's top finisher at the GWC Cross Country Championships as he placed second overall. He also shattered three distance school records in outdoor track as he broke the 3,000, 5,000, and 10,000-meter records. Buhler recently finished in second place in the 5,000- and 10,000-meter events at the GWC Outdoor Track & Field Championships.
Nominations and voting for the All-America programs are conducted by members of the College Sports Information Directors of America (CoSIDA).
There is a University Division (Division I programs) and a College Division (DII, DIII, NAIA, NJCAA programs).
Three Academic All-District teams are chosen in each district, with those on the All-District first teams placed on the national ballot for Academic All-America consideration.
